>> "It's my understanding that they can't for six months." <<
No, that's not true. If Davis had won, a new recall could not be brought against him for six months, but a recall could be brought immediately against a new Governor.
However, it really is not that easy to bring a recall. This has been the first successfull recall in the history of CA. Many have been tried, none have succeeded.
